Long Distance Removal Costs UK: What to Expect and How to Save

Long-distance removal costs are driven by mileage, van time, and scheduling complexity. What usually increases cost: - 100+ mile routes - Multi-day loading and delivery windows - Difficult city access and parking restrictions - Larger inventory requiring bigger vehicles Typical planning steps: - Lock your inventory early - Confirm loading and unloading access in writing - Ask whether overnight stays are included - Check if shared loads (groupage) are an option How to reduce cost: - Move off-peak where possible - Reduce volume before quoting - Compare fixed quotes with clear route assumptions For UK north-south moves and regional relocations, route planning quality is often the difference between a smooth move and expensive delays.

Frequently asked questions

What drives long-distance removal prices most?

Mileage, crew time, route complexity, and overnight scheduling are the main pricing drivers.

Are shared loads useful for long-distance moves?

Shared loads can reduce price on flexible timelines, especially for smaller volumes.

How can I avoid add-on costs on long routes?

Get fixed quotes with written assumptions on access, waiting time, and what is included.
